In certain frontal collisions, the pre-tensioner will activate and pull the seat belt into tighter contact against the occupant's body. The purpose of the pre-tensioner is to make sure that the seat belts fit tightly against the occupant's body in certain frontal collisions. The pre-tensioner seat belts may be activated in crashes where the frontal collision is severe enough.
